Kadiri: A Town and Mandal in Anantapur district

Kadiri is a town and Mandal in the Anantapur district of the Andhra Pradesh. In India, a Mandal is a subdivision of a district responsible for the administration and revenue collection of a specific area within the district. Mandals play a crucial role in the local governance structure, contributing significantly to the development and administration of their communities.

Overview of Kadiri Mandal

According to the 2011 census The total area of Kadiri Mandal is 243 km², with a population of 125373 people. The population density is 517 inhabitants per square kilometre, and there are approximately 29935 houses in the sub district.

Population Distribution

The population is distributed between urban and rural areas as follows:

ParticularsRuralUrbanTotal
Total Population 35944 89429 125373
Male Population 18073 44375 62448
Female Population 17871 45054 62925
Population Density 166 / km² 3456 / km² 517 / km²

Household Distribution

The distribution of households in the Kadiri is:

Rural HouseholdsUrban HouseholdsTotal Households
9154 20781 29935
